PSYCHIATRIC SOCIAL WORKER I/STIPEND (NONCOMPETITIVE)
About the role
The County of Los Angeles seeks a professional Social Worker to provide mental health services to clients in need. This role involves interviewing clients, assessing their functioning, developing treatment plans, and providing various forms of therapy.
Responsibilities
- Interviews individuals, families, and significant others to gather comprehensive background information.
- Affirms client's functioning in their environment and develops a treatment plan.
- Conducts therapy sessions individually, in groups, with families, and with significant others.
- Engages in case management to secure necessary resources for clients.
- Assesses and evaluates the behavior of individuals to determine if they require hospitalization.
- Provides crisis intervention and assists clients in managing emotional crises.
- Works with families and significant others to support their acceptance and participation in treatment.
- Participates in multidisciplinary team meetings to evaluate clients' progress and develop treatment plans.
- Contributes to research projects to improve therapeutic methods and understand mental health issues.
Requirements
- A master's degree in Social Work from an accredited college or university, with supervised field work experience in psychiatric social work.
- A valid and active Associate Clinical Social Worker registration issued by the California Department of Consumer Affairs, Board of Behavioral Sciences.
- Completion of the required education within six months of employment.
- A valid California Class C Driver License or equivalent transportation method.
Special Requirements
- Physical Class II – Light physical effort, including occasional light lifting and some bending, stooping, or squatting.
- Stipend recipients must provide a copy of their Stipend Contracts or an official letter from their school verifying their stipend status.
